NDLEA marks Kyari’s Maiduguri houses, shopping plaza for investigation
Six residential houses and one plaza in Maiduguri belonging to the embattled former Intelligence Response Team chief, Abba Kyari, were designated as under investigation by the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ency on Monday.
Assurance Plaza, a two-story retail mall on Maiduguri’s Giwa Barracks Road, includes approximately 100 stores.
The NDLEA had also identified six other residential residences in Maiduguri’s New Government Residential Area that reportedly belonged to the suspended Deputy Commissioner of Police.
